6-CHLORO-7-DEAZA-9-(2',3',5'-TRI-O-ACETYL-BETA-D-RIBOFURANOSYL)PURINE

Description:
6-Chloro-7-deaza-9-(2',3',5'-tri-O-acetyl-beta-D-ribofuranosyl)purine is a purine derivative characterized by the presence of a chlorine atom at the 6-position and a deaza substitution at the 7-position of the purine ring. The compound features a ribofuranosyl moiety that is fully acetylated at the 2', 3', and 5' hydroxyl groups, which enhances its stability and lipophilicity. This structural modification can influence its biological activity, making it a potential candidate for nucleoside analogs in medicinal chemistry. The presence of the deaza substitution alters the electronic properties of the purine base, potentially affecting its interaction with nucleic acid targets. The compound is of interest in research related to antiviral and anticancer therapies, as modifications to nucleosides can lead to improved efficacy and reduced toxicity. Its CAS number, 16754-79-3, allows for easy identification in chemical databases and literature. Overall, this compound exemplifies the intricate design of nucleoside analogs for therapeutic applications.
Formula:C17H18ClN3O7
InChI:InChI=1/C17H18ClN3O7/c1-8(22)25-6-12-13(26-9(2)23)14(27-10(3)24)17(28-12)21-5-4-11-15(18)19-7-20-16(11)21/h4-5,7,12-14,17H,6H2,1-3H3/t12-,13+,14+,17-/m1/s1
